IoT-based Hydroponic Plant Monitoring System Fadillah Fadillah; Relita Buaton; Suci Ramadani
Journal of Artificial Intelligence and Engineering Applications (JAIEA) Vol. 3 No. 1 (2023): October 2023
Publisher : Yayasan Kita Menulis

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.59934/jaiea.v3i1.255

Abstract

The Industrial Revolution 4.0 has an impact in the form of changes in various fields of human civilization, one of which is the agricultural sector. By applying IoT technology, hydroponic plants will effectively be accurate. IoT has room for improvement in the quality and quantity of agricultural production because it facilitates the automation of monitoring various processes with high precision This research uses the prototype method. Which uses the concept of direct monitoring and allows iterative changes to be made until the desired results are achieved. So this prototype method makes it possible to display the display directly. The microcontroller used is ESP32 which is connected to 3 sensors, namely the TDS sensor, DHT11 sensor and HC-SR04 sensor which are directly updated in the blynk application. In making the software program used is the Arduino IDE. Implementation of the tool is carried out on a floating raft installation. This iot-based hydroponic plant monitoring system has been successfully made and is able to monitor well. Because the system made is related to water, it is necessary to design a tool that is safer and has more protection so that it can’t only run well but also safer for users and a high level of durability.

Application of Data Mining in Analyzing the Effect of Parents' Employment and Education Level on Student Behavior Using the A PRIORI Method (Case Study: SDN 024769 Binjai) Suha Baby Mayaza; Relita Buaton; Suci Ramadani
Journal of Artificial Intelligence and Engineering Applications (JAIEA) Vol. 3 No. 1 (2023): October 2023
Publisher : Yayasan Kita Menulis

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.59934/jaiea.v3i1.279

Abstract

Behavior is a person's reaction to a stimulus that comes from the external environment. Parents are one of the main factors in the formation of children's behavior. This study aims to find out the effect of parents' work and education on student behavior. By using RapidMiner in testing 234 SDN 024769 Binjai student data, using the Apriori method and setting a minimum support value of 8% and 70% confidence, 1207 rules were obtained in the entire set and 2 rules in 9 itemsets. And the best rule with the highest value is obtained, if the father's job is self-employed, the mother's job is self-employed, the father's last education is high school, the mother's last education is high school, the time the father spends working is more than 8 hours per day, the time the mother spends working is more than 8 hours per day, the time the father spends on family is every day, and the time the mother spends on family is every day then the student has good behavior at school, with a support value of 8.5% and a certainty value of 95.2%.
